Robin Morton Collection. Reel-to-Reel 21 [sound recording] / [various performers]
Fait partie de Robin Morton Collection
Performers:
Gunn, Tommy, speech in English throughout, fiddle solo A1, 9, singing in English A1, 2;
Morton, Robin, speech in English throughout
Running Order:
1. Speech/Air/Song: My Own Native Land Far Away [Erin Gra Mo Chroi], mention of Katie Gunn
2. Speech/Song: The Jazz Dance (composed by performer)
3. Speech: talk about jazz dances, modern dances, The Starlight Dance Band, the decline of traditonal music and dances, radio, record players, records from America, television, Comhaltas and the revival of traditional music
4. Speech: talk about the recordings from America, Micheal Coleman's recordings, Phil Martin's Ceili Band, the effect of Coleman's recordings on musicians, changing repetoire
5. Speech: talk about the changing repertoire of local young musicians, changes in local style, Morrison, John McKenna, Tommy McBrine, Frank McGovern
6. Speech: talk about popular instruments at the time, fiddle, accordion, Hugh Lee, Phil Martin, Brian Boru pipes
7. Speech: talk about good places for music in the locality, Andy Carne, Hugh Gunn, John Mac, John Eddie's house, Old Tom's house, Paddy Gunn's house
8. Speech: talk about local people composing tunes and songs, Eddie Corrigan
9. Speech/Reel: The Yellow Heifer
10. Speech/March: March to Vinegar Hill [END OF BAND ONE]
